Location: Mohali
Experience: 5 to 8 Years
Responsibilities:
- Develop and Implement Telecom Solutions: Design, develop, and maintain telecom applications using Asterisk and SIP protocol, ensuring high performance and scalability.
- Backend Development: Utilize NodeJS to build robust backend services and APIs, integrating with telecom systems and ensuring seamless communication between various components.
- Collaborate with Architects and Developers: Work closely with a team of architects and developers to translate
requirements into technical solutions, participating in design and code reviews to ensure quality and adherence to
best practices. - Optimize and Scale Applications: Focus on optimizing the performance of telecom applications, implementing
scalable solutions to handle growing traffic and user demands. - Integrate with CRM Systems: Work on integrating telecom applications with CRM systems such as Salesforce, Zoho,
Leads Square, and others, ensuring seamless data flow and synchronization across platforms. - Troubleshoot and Debug: Identify, diagnose, and resolve complex issues in telecom systems, ensuring minimal
downtime and high availability of services. - Stay Updated with Industry Trends: Keep up to date with the latest trends and technologies in the telecom domain,
especially around Asterisk, SIP, NodeJS, and CRM integrations, applying this knowledge to enhance application
features and performance.
Qualifications:
- Experience in Telecom Domain: Proven experience in developing telecom applications, with a strong understanding
of Asterisk and SIP protocols. - Proficiency in NodeJS: Extensive experience in backend development using NodeJS, with a solid understanding of asynchronous programming, event-driven architecture, and RESTful API development.
- Knowledge of Telecom Protocols: In-depth understanding of telecom protocols, especially SIP, and hands-on
experience with Asterisk PBX. - CRM Integration Experience: Familiarity with integrating telecom systems with CRM platforms like Salesforce, Zoho,
- Leads Square, or similar systems is highly desirable.
- Problem-Solving Skills: Strong analytical and problem-solving skills, with the ability to troubleshoot complex telecom
systems and optimize performance. - Team Collaboration: Excellent communication skills, with experience working in collaborative environments, and the
ability to contribute to a high-performance team. - Educational Background: A degree in Computer Science, Telecommunications, or a related field is preferred, but
equivalent work experience will also be considered. - Additional Skills: Familiarity with other telecom-related technologies, VoIP, WebRTC, and cloud-based telephony
solutions, would be an added advantage.